The whole point is not to be alone in the process. A lot of the time, caregivers of someone who needs care end up doing everything by themselves, not because they want to, but because involving someone else feels complicated.
You don't always trust others with something this personal, or it's just too much effort to transfer all the information, routines, and context, so you take the easier route and keep it to yourself, and then there are the family members who aren't nearby but genuinely want to know how things are going, and keeping them updated takes more time and energy than you actually have.
The app helps with:
- Logging day-to-day notes, what worked, what didn't, special moments worth remembering.
- Planning repeatable tasks so someone else can step in and actually understand the routine.
- Building a full profile of the person you're caring for, and printing a care card you can hand to any nurse, hospital, or new carer.
It's designed for families supporting loved ones with dementia, Alzheimer's, or any condition that is similar.
